    Default Hostel / Shuttle Services - Daleville, VA

    I'm planning a section hike for this spring and plan to do about 108 miles from VA 630 "Sinking Creek" to VA 130 "Big Island, VA".

    Because of a bad back - I will likely need to slackpack much of the way.

    I was hoping to find a hostel / Shuttle provider in Daleville, VA. from which to base my trip.

    Any recommendations would be greatly appreciated.

    I used Homer Witcher for shuttles there, he’s a great guy and as a bonus, he and his Wife maintain a large number of shelters, so he really knows the trail (Also a thruhiker and still runs trails in his 80’s.) The hotel just off the trail is also very hiker friendly, great staff. He uses a flip phone so you need to call him.

    For a shuttler, go with Homer Witcher (540-266-4849). As previously stated, he's a great guy with tons of knowledge to offer on that section (including slackpacking guidance). Very reasonable rates, as well.

    Yeah, I'd recommend Homer W. too. Also, if there is a day or two you can't line up a shuttler, try Uber. They run out there and I've used them out of Daleville before.

    Also give Outdoor Trails a call. They're right by the Daleville highway crossing on 220 and will be up to speed on any local info.
